ELECTRON-UI组件库:电子用户界面的开发利器

需积分: 20 0 下载量 64 浏览量 更新于2024-12-07 收藏 134KB ZIP 举报
资源摘要信息:"ELECTRON-UI是一个电子用户界面组件库,主要使用CSS来实现界面的样式设计和布局。" 在深入探讨ELECTRON-UI之前,我们首先需要了解ELECTRON本身。ELECTRON是一个开源框架,主要用于构建跨平台的桌面应用程序,通过使用Node.js(JavaScript运行时)和Chromium(开源浏览器项目)来实现。ELECTRON使得开发者能够使用前端技术(HTML、CSS、JavaScript)来创建具有原生应用程序性能的应用程序。 而ELECTRON-UI作为ELECTRON的一个组件库,主要关注于提供一系列可复用的用户界面组件,使得开发者能够在使用ELECTRON框架开发应用程序时,能够更加高效地设计出美观且功能完善的用户界面。组件库是现代前端开发中常见的一个概念,通过定义好一系列的UI组件(如按钮、输入框、列表、卡片等),使得开发者可以在不同的页面中复用这些组件,不仅提高了开发效率,也有助于保持界面的一致性。 由于提到的【标签】是CSS,我们可以知道ELECTRON-UI组件库在实现界面的时候,会大量依赖CSS技术。CSS(层叠样式表)是用于描述网页内容表现形式的语言,它定义了网页上的元素如何显示,例如颜色、布局、字体等。在ELECTRON-UI中,CSS将负责定义组件的样式,包括但不限于颜色方案、尺寸、布局、动画效果和交互反馈等。 ELECTRON-UI组件库可能提供以下几种类型的组件: 1. 布局组件:用于页面的结构划分,如容器、网格、面板等。 2. 数据展示组件:用于展示信息,如表格、列表、卡片等。 3. 输入组件:用于用户与应用交互,如文本框、选择框、按钮、开关等。 4. 导航组件:用于页面之间的跳转,如菜单、标签页、侧边栏等。 5. 反馈组件:用于向用户展示应用的状态,如提示信息、加载动画等。 由于【压缩包子文件的文件名称列表】中只有一个项ELECTRON-UI-main,这可能表明该组件库的源代码是打包在一个压缩包内的,文件名“main”可能意味着这是一个入口文件或主要文件,通常在ELECTRON项目中,“main”文件指的是启动应用的主要JavaScript文件,它负责创建窗口、加载页面和处理系统事件等。 开发者在使用ELECTRON-UI组件库时,需要考虑到组件库的设计原则,比如是否遵循一致的设计语言、是否容易进行主题定制和样式覆盖、是否支持响应式设计等。由于组件库是基于CSS的,开发者需要具备一定的CSS知识,以便能够根据项目需求自定义样式或者对组件进行必要的样式调整。 总结来说,ELECTRON-UI组件库为使用ELECTRON框架的开发者提供了一套便捷的工具集,使得开发者能够更加专注于业务逻辑的实现,而不需要从零开始设计和实现每一个用户界面元素。同时,组件库的CSS基础使得开发者能够灵活地调整和优化界面的外观,以达到期望的用户体验效果。